当前位置:新闻资讯 > 软件开发未来发展趋势解析

软件开发未来发展趋势解析

拜腾软件
浏览量5614 时间刚刚

科学技术的发展从未停止过前进的脚步,只有技术的发展紧跟为了在企业的竞争中立于不败之地。软件的设计和开发也是如此。因此,软件开发的未来发展趋势会是什么样呢?

科学技术的发展从未停止过前进的脚步,只有技术的发展紧跟为了在企业的竞争中立于不败之地。软件的设计和开发也是如此。因此,软件开发的未来发展趋势会是什么样呢?

在众多的软件开发企业技术中,AI是热点。在过去的五年里,AI发展经济迅猛。如今,机器也可以像人脑一样的思考问题了。人们所说的AI技术主要包括国家机器通过学习、深度合作学习和神经系统网络。

在最近的一项调查,84%的受访表示,他们认为AI实现可以提供具有竞争力的优势。该技术及其相关技术(如机器学习,深度学习和NLP)有大量的在各个行业的应用。这是使用广泛的聊天机器人(机器人对话)的,聊天机器人在人多的地方,为客户提供替代服务,如查询,排序等。与人相比,对这种服务机器人对话错不了。据市场研究公司Tractica分析,全球AI软件市场规模将在95十亿美元增长到2018年增长到118.6十亿美元在2025年这一惊人的数字增长,AI告诉我们,不仅是未来的技术发展趋势,而真正的今天在技​​术领域的重要力量。 AI技术被广泛应用于医疗,金融,教育,交通,自动测试,自动代码生成和自动化解决方案的开发。即使是大赦国际还预测市场状况需求和供应链软件,以减少开销并重新安排送货等。




2020年软件进行开发过程中一项有趣的趋势分析就是沉浸式技术。沉浸式技术主要包括网络虚拟社会现实VR、增强企业现实AR和VR,AR的组合混合现实。该技术研究正在以一种加速度的方式迅猛发展。虚拟现实和增强学生现实的不断完善改进,每年都在自己创造新的奇迹。

除了在游戏里运用外,沉浸式技术还被应用到其它领域。如沃尔玛利用VR来为员工做服务培训。微软的Hololen的MR技术被美国军方采纳。仿真软件VituralShip被用来训练美国海军和海岸卫队军官。在电子商务app中,AR同样以各种方式使用,增加客户购物体验的真实性和互动性。电子商务仓库配备VR,让用户可以在下单前虚拟体验一下。

从训练军队到3d 游戏,混合现实在今天的每一个利基市场都可以买到。基于虚拟现实的教育应用是教育服务技术发展到一个新水平的新趋势。混合技术允许人们参观博物馆,获得更深层次的体验,更广泛地购物,并拥有更刺激的游戏体验。当局预测,到2022年,70% 的企业将使用 ar/vr,对 ar 开发者的需求将会增加。Industryabc 的数据显示,未来几年,喜忧参半的全球市场预计将大幅增长,从2017年的10亿美元增至2024年的100亿美元。复合年增长率达到73.2% 

目前。谷歌,三星和Oculus公司VR是市场的主要参与者。等一大批新兴公司的基于虚拟现实技术开发服务,紧追沃尔玛和美国军队等巨头。

这项技术有很多值得我们探索的方面,它们可以极大地改善社会生活学习方式和业务管理流程。

在过去的几年里,Android应用开发者认识到网站和移动应用程序的优势,进行Web应用程序(PWA)来到在这种情况下是。网站允许用户轻松导航与浏览器,移动应用程序可以充分利用系统的硬件和软件,从而PWA结合两者的优点。 PWA不需要搜索的用户到应用程序商店,然后下载并安装,也可以直接从网站上找到。 PWA有一个移动应用程序的所有功能,包括消息推送的内容,可以有效地提高用户参与度,增加了产品的转换,如电力供应商,银行,旅游,媒体和医疗应用。

PWA可以运行在中国移动电子设备、台式机以及平板电脑,不会导致出现没有什么兼容问题,为用户管理提供跨设备无缝体验。

在PWA应用技术目前宝马官方网站,会话的移动终端用户增加了50%,新账户的用户应用程序添加到主屏幕比例比以前增加了150%以上。速卖通PWA应用技术,起重会话104%的量。

低代码开发于2014年推出,旨在提高软件开发效率,减少手工编程的数量。低代码开发平台为用户提供可视化图形界面。开发人员,即使你是一个非技术人员,也可以参与编程。可以使用业务逻辑,拖放相应的过程模块,构建完成的程序框架,并让平台自动生成代码。Appian 和 mendix 是两个比较好的低代码开发平台。

到2019年,低源平台预计将在2018年产生10 $十亿的收入是双重的。的技术打开了非技术人员,以加快开发进程的大门,是一个很好的计划,以减少上线时间。

低代码进行开发并不是一种通用的解决问题方案。对于一个复杂的任务和开发式流程,定制化软件系统开发学生还是最好的选择。具有非常明确发展目标和清晰工作流程和结构的产品是用低代码开发技术平台通过构建的理想选择。

谷歌趋势表明,微服务架构模式继续在2019年增长,整整一年。

随着我国软件进行行业企业整体发展逐步迁移到云端,微服务也将成为占主导地位的架构范式。与往日设计作为一个非常庞大的系统分析不同,微服务是把整体管理功能分割成可控的若干小模块,每个小模块主要就是这样一个比较完整的功能模块。用户可以根据公司业务工作需要,选择相应的模块,组合成最后的系统。(设计教学思路跟Function as a Service类似)

微服务体系结构兴起的主要原因之一是它与云原点非常吻合,能够实现快速的软件开发。

随着动态软件技术的发展,其开发工具在市场上并不稳定。虽然在所有其他调查中,javascript 和 php 是前端和后端编程中最常用的编程语言。但是还有很多其他的工具正在流行。一个是 python,它是人工智能和机器学习开发中最常用的。Python 的阴影无处不在: 机器学习,数据分析,数据处理,web 开发,企业软件开发,甚至拼接黑洞照片。

在编程第三位,仅次于Java和C语言中最流行的编程语言之间的语言网站TIOBE,Python的著名名单。在2019年,Python的普及加倍(从5%至10%)。

Python 的崛起发展将在 2020 年延续,并缩短与 Java 和 C 语言环境之间的差距。另一门无所不能不在的编程设计语言 JavaScript 正面临经济下行的风险。为什么 Python 的势头会如此具有强劲?因为它的入手进行门槛低,有一个中国优秀的社区在支持,并受到相关数据信息科学教育家和企业新生代技术开发者的喜爱。

数据上云已经发展成为一个企业管理信息进行处理的一种重要趋势。当用户对数据分析处理的实时性提出更高的需求时,云计算的问题(时延)就暴露出来了。边缘计算的思路是把用户通过数据迁移到网络边缘设备,利用边缘设备来为用户可以提供技术处理工作能力。

相对于把海量信息数据传送到相关数据管理中心去处理企业而言,在边缘检测设备上就地解决这些问题学生更能节省工作时间和开销。对于一个终端用户个人而言,这就意味着更快地实时分析处理技术数据。随着5G时代的到来,传输速度成百倍提高,比如20Gbps,这样让数据可以传输的时延微乎其微。大带宽,低时延赋予了边缘计算得到更多新式应用的可能。此外,边缘计算能力特别适用于不同处理学习时间和区域敏感的数据。

随着全球软件开发越来越复杂,软件外包逐渐成为一种趋势。 软件外包为企业提供了一种灵活经济的发展方法。 例如派克(济南)信息技术有限公司,专业提供济南软件外包服务,一站式解决企业软件开发需求。 当企业自己的研发团队缺乏专业技能时,企业不必单独招聘或再培训,但可以选择外包这部分工作。 即使它有能力在某些领域发展,但考虑到成本或专业因素,也可以外包,以获得最大的性价比。



欢迎关注我们的公众号
                    
Tag: 软件开发 软件设计
多一次沟通多一份选择 联系我们

157-3031-3844

24小时售前咨询

微信洽谈

关注公众号

商务洽谈: 157-3031-3844

微信号码: yelijun1193

成都市高新区天府三街69号

Copyright ©️2018-2022版权所有:拜腾科技(成都)有限公司.All Rights Reserved. 蜀ICPB备19023477号

在线咨询

电话咨询

电话咨询

微信咨询

微信咨询